Clinical support worker | the christie nhs foundation trust

Manchester
The Christie NHS Foundation Trust
Clinical support worker
Posted: 28 March
Offer description

An exciting opportunity has arisen for a full time, permanent position in the Clinical Support Team at the Christie Proton Beam Therapy (PBT) Centre in Withington, Manchester. The role of the Clinical Support Worker (CSW) involves a varied range of duties incorporating both clerical and clinical skills, supporting the patient and the service throughout their course of treatment with PBT. Working with patients on a daily basis, the CSW is responsible for supportive duties alongside radiographers in treatment and imaging, as well as clerical and administrative work. Some experience in healthcare is preferable but not essential; training will be provided for this highly specialised role.

Working shifts cover the needs of the service. Example shifts include 7am‑3pm and 11am‑7pm, which may vary depending on the work area. The position is permanent, 37.5hrs over 5 days.


Key Responsibilities

* Assist the clinical teams in supporting patients while they are receiving treatment, including assisting radiographers in the production, management and maintenance of radiotherapy immobilisation devices;
* Liaise with patients on a daily basis, building rapport and feeding back important information to the clinical team;
* Perform clinical duties such as changing dressings, capturing and recording of patient clinical observations;
* Complete a range of administrative duties using Trust systems to capture and record information, track and maintain patient records;
* Provide support to the department by ensuring accurate recording of treatment and planning data, organising and scheduling patient appointments, greeting and escorting patients, and assisting with appointment queries;
* Support radiotherapy staff with the physical, clinical and emotional needs of patients, including care of postoperative patients, changing dressings, tracheostomy support, and working with patients that have communication difficulties;
* Liaise between all Christie radiotherapy centres, host sites and community when appropriate;
* Use knowledge of the integrated clinical information system for case note tracking and collating data for referrals, data input and radiotherapy completion tasks, and retrieval of medical documents from other Trusts;
* Comply with policies, procedures, rules, regulations and departmental protocols;
* Produce suitable immobilisation equipment and provide clinical support for radiotherapy anaesthetic and recovery areas;
* Work under the direction of PBT radiographers to undertake routine and specifically identified tasks after training and competency completion;
* Maintain accurate patient details in all Christie patient systems, following correct procedures for recording information and ensuring data protection compliance;
* Triage and manage booking forms, book and schedule radiotherapy planning and treatment across all sites, arrange patient transport, and schedule physiotherapy and complementary therapy;
* Produce departmental statistics, ensure submission within deadlines, use analytical skills to judge patient situations and decide when issues need escalation;
* Cover the reception desk as needed and answer internal or external telephone calls;
* Control stock, produce and process completion letters, create follow‑up letters, support pre‑treatment imaging and prepare patients for diagnostic procedures;
* Provide continuity of support during absences of other CSWs and booking team members;
* Support all Christie clinics, including AHP services, and organise relevant medical equipment, including sterilisation;
* Utilise own initiative within defined SOPs, procedures and policies, seeking guidance when unsure;
* Assist with patient transfer and manual handling tasks as required;
* Attend all relevant mandatory training courses, maintain personal development, participate in training, meetings and work at The Christie Withington site and satellite sites;
* Assist in the training and orientation of other CSWs and students, complete the Christie Care Certificate as mandated, and demonstrate tasks to new members.


Skills and Experience

* Excellent communication skills, able to support patients and carers of all ages, including a large number of paediatric patients and families travelling from all over the UK;
* Strong teamwork ethic, willingness to interact with a range of professions;
* Good IT skills and willingness to learn multiple Trust IT systems;
* Flexibility to adapt to evolving workloads and shift patterns;
* Willingness to work flexible hours, including weekends and all shift patterns if required.
